Colleges must shape next generation to lead country with socialist values
The goal of China's education is to nurture a new generation of capable young people who are well-prepared to join the socialist cause, President Xi Jinping said on Wednesday.
Xi, also general secretary of the Communist Party of China Central Committee and chairman of the Central Military Commission, made the remark while talking with students and teachers at Peking University in Beijing.
Universities should focus on their task of nurturing young people and prepare them to join the socialist cause, uphold their proper political direction, form a high-standard system to cultivate talent and build world-class programs with Chinese characteristics, Xi said.
